Mobile Air Conditioning/Chiller Service Engineer - Southern Region of the UK

We are seeking experienced and qualified Mobile Air Conditioning/Chiller Service Engineers to join our team and maintain and repair clients' equipment in the mobile and static medical industry across the Southern area of the UK. As a crucial member of our team, you will work with some of the UK's leading providers of logistics and maintenance services.

We’re looking for qualified F-Gas Engineers that are experienced with chillers, air conditioning, electrical installations and repairs, having suitable qualifications including 17th edition and inspection test certificate.

The engineer will, at times, be required to work away from home, with hotels provided.

This role will be working a contracted 45 hour week (with one hour unpaid lunch per day). Working flexibly any five days out of seven, including some regular weekends on a rota basis (rota to be confirmed with successful applicant).

1 in approximately every 6 weeks will be working an out of hours on call rota system, which will be rewarded with an on call allowance plus hourly pay when required to go out to a breakdown. Additional overtime is also available.
